• Coaxial cable is the cable that comes in from your antenna,cable TV service,
or cable converterbox.Coaxialcable uses"F' connectors.
• Standard stereo PJV cables usuallycome in sets of three,and are typically
color-coded accordingto use:yellow for video,red for stereoright audio, and
white for stereoleft (or mono)audio. Your TV's standardA/V inputs are
color-coded in the same manneras the cables.
• S-Video cable is for use with videoequipmentthat has S-Videoconnectors.
• Component video cables come in sets of three (typicallycolor-coded red,
green, and blue), and are for use with video equipmentthat has component
video connectors.Your TV's ColorStream® (componentvideo) inputs are color-
coded in the samemanner asthe cables.
NOTEREGARDINGPICTUREQUALITY
When connectingvideo equipmentto your ToshibaTV:
• For GOOD picture quality: Usea standard yellow video cable.
• For BETTERpicture quality: If your equipment has S-video connectors,use
an S-video cable instead of a standardyellow videocable. (You still must
connect the standard red andwhite audio cablesfor full systemconnection,
but do not connecta standardyeiiow video cableat the sametimeor the
picture performancewill be unacceptable.)
• For BESTpicture quality: If your equipment has componentvideo
connectors,use componentvideo cables instead of a standardyellow video
cableor S-videocable. (You still mustconnect the standardred and white
audio cables for full systemconnection.)

Connecting a VCR
This connection allows you to watch local channels and video
programs, play or record on the VCR while watching _, and record
from one channel while watching another channel.
You will need:
• two coaxial cables (one or more may be provided by your cable
company)
• one pair of audio cables (one single cable for a mono VCR)
• one video cable

Note:
Ifyou have a mono VCR, connect L/Mono to
VCRAudio OUT using only one audio cable.
ffyou have an S-VHS VCR,use an S-video
cable instead of a standard video cable for
better picture performance.
Do not connect a standard videocable and
an S-video cable to Video-1 (or Video-2_at
the same time or the picture performance will
be unacceptable.
